Output 6ffa8630e56733eee3db091f791640d740c507b4b5e4fcb61e3bae6e0aa3ef92:151

value
205366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a906b5fef578c387b59d8d1e8c45e1923ccef033 OP_EQUAL
address
3H6kAFE9HzK8V5qNwQi8vrWCXAYSfvPCTq
transaction
6ffa8630e56733eee3db091f791640d740c507b4b5e4fcb61e3bae6e0aa3ef92
confirmations
228984
spent
true